Cyberonics Stockholders Overwhelmingly Approve Merger With Sorin Group S.p.A.

HOUSTON, Sept. 22, 2015 /PRNewswire/ -- Cyberonics, Inc. (NASDAQ: CYBX, "Cyberonics") today announced that its stockholders voted to adopt the merger agreement providing for the business combination of Cyberonics and Sorin S.p.A. (MTA; Reuters Code: SORN.MI, "Sorin") at the special meeting of Cyberonics stockholders held earlier today.  More than 98.8 percent of votes cast at the special meeting were in favor of the transaction, representing more than 84.2 percent of all outstanding shares of Cyberonics.

Sorin and Cyberonics announced on February 26, 2015 that the boards of directors of both companies unanimously approved a combination of the companies (the "Transaction") under a newly formed holding company organized under the laws of England and Wales, LivaNova PLC ("LivaNova").  The Transaction was overwhelmingly approved by Sorin shareholders on May 26, 2015.

The Transaction will create a new premier global medical technology company.  LivaNova will have a strategic presence in over 100 countries on five continents around the world, with approximately 4,500 employees.  The Transaction, which is expected to close in the fourth calendar quarter of 2015, remains subject to the satisfaction of certain closing conditions set forth in the transaction agreement.

About Cyberonics
Cyberonics, Inc. is a medical device company with core expertise in neuromodulation. The company developed and markets the VNS Therapy® System, which is FDA-approved for the treatment of medically refractory epilepsy and treatment-resistant depression. The VNS Therapy System uses an implanted medical device that delivers pulsed electrical signals to the vagus nerve. Cyberonics offers the VNS Therapy System in selected markets worldwide. Cyberonics also has CE Mark for the VITARIA System, which provides autonomic regulation therapy for the treatment of chronic heart failure.
